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5356129 08693981589 45773012637
72521780 43180340
72521780 43180340
487845 30032 120 188721441
All about undefined
Interested in learning more?
72521780 43180340
487845 30032 120 188721441
See more
0066306601 2465
308876875 727 98023180821 47595 41
See more
359 6604038376
2502551546 5468 77
See more